Programming/ActionScript3.0
9강. 외부 swf 불러오기
노란날.
2011. 3. 31. 16:24
반응형
var arr:Array = new Array();
for (var i:int=0; i<2; i++) {
var loader:Loader = new Loader();
arr[i]=loader;
this.addChild(loader);
loader.load(new URLRequest("window"+i+".swf"));
loader.x=100+i*50;
loader.y=100+i*50;
}
for (i=0; i<2; i++) {
this["m"+i].addEventListener(MouseEvent.CLICK,onClick);
}
function onClick(e:MouseEvent):void {
var id:Number=e.currentTarget.name.charAt(1);
var urlReq:URLRequest=new URLRequest("window"+id+".swf");
arr[id].load(urlReq);
this.addChild(arr[id]);
arr[id].x=100+id*50;
arr[id].y=100+id*50;
}
반응형